Breathing is not just a vital function of life, but also a key factor in your core stability. Your core muscles, which include your diaphragm, pelvic floor, transverse abdominis, and multifidus, work together to support your spine and posture. How you breathe can affect how these muscles contract and relax, and how well they coordinate with each other.
